The NDIS is a government program in Australia that provides support and services to individuals with permanent and significant disabilities. It offers funding for personalised assistance, therapy services, assistive technology, and community participation programs to help people achieve their goals and enhance their well-being.
To determine eligibility for the National Disability Insurance Scheme (NDIS), individuals must meet certain criteria outlined by the Australian government. Generally, to be eligible, you must:

- Have a permanent and significant disability that impacts your ability to participate effectively in everyday activities.
- Be an Australian citizen, permanent resident, or hold a Protected Special Category Visa.
- Be under the age of 65 when you first apply for the NDIS.
- Live in an area where the NDIS is available and meet residency requirements.

To confirm eligibility and apply for the NDIS, individuals can contact the National Disability Insurance Agency (NDIA) or visit their website for more information and assistance with the application process.
To access the NDIS, check eligibility and apply online or contact the NDIA for assistance. After an assessment, an individualised plan is developed and approved. Then, access NDIS-funded supports and services tailored to your needs, with regular plan reviews to ensure they meet evolving requirements.
You can manage your NDIS funding by either taking control yourself, appointing a plan manager, or having the NDIA manage it directly for you. Choose the method that suits you best to ensure your funding is used effectively to achieve your goals.
You can receive various supports tailored to your needs through the NDIS, such as assistance with daily activities, therapy services, mobility aids, home modifications, employment support, and community activities. Your specific supports are outlined in your NDIS plan, based on your goals and assessment.
